多层螺旋CT多平面重建后处理技术对肺内占位良恶性的鉴别诊断意义 被引量:25

Multi-slice spiral CT multi-planar reconstruction and post-processing technique for differential diagnosis of benign and malignant lesions in the lung

摘要 目的:探讨多层螺旋CT多平面重建后处理技术对肺内占位良恶性的鉴别诊断意义。方法:2016年5月到2018年6月选择在我院进行诊治的肺内占位病变患者194例,所有患者均给予常规多层螺旋CT与CT多平面重建后处理技术检查,记录影像学特征,并判断鉴别诊断良恶性的效果。结果:在194例患者中,病理诊断为良性病变100例(良性组),诊断为恶性病变94例(恶性组),恶性组与良性组CT常规特征中的分叶征、锯齿征、毛刺征、血管聚集征、空泡征等比例差异显著(P<0.05)。所有患者CT多平面重建后处理图像均可清晰显示肺动脉,不同重建方法显示肺部血管有高度一致性,重建评分对比差异无统计学意义(P>0.05)。多层螺旋CT多平面重建后处理鉴别诊断肺内占位病变良恶性的阳性预测值、阴性预测值、灵敏度以及特异度分别为90.5%、91.9%、91.5%和91.0%。结论:多层螺旋CT多平面重建后处理技术在肺内占位病变中的应用获取图像清晰,重建区域自由,能有效鉴别诊断良恶性状况。 Objective:To investigate the differential diagnosis of benign and malignant lesions in the lung by multi-slice spiral CT multi-planar reconstruction.Methods:From May 2016 to June 2018,194 patients with intrapulmonary lesions were selected and treated in our hospital.All patients were given conventional multi-slice spiral CT multi-planar reconstruction,recorded the features,and were to judge the effects of differential diagnosis of benign and malignant.Results:In the 194 patients,there were 100 patients were pathologically diagnosed as benign lesions(benign group),and 94 patients were diagnosed as malignant lesions(malignant group).The proportion of lobular sign,sawtooth sign,burr sign,and vascular aggregation in the malignant group were significantly lower than that of the benign group by the conventional CT(P<0.05).Pulmonary arteries were clearly displayed in all patients with CT multiplanar reconstruction,and the different reconstruction methods were all showed high degree of consistency in the pulmonary vessels.There were no significant difference compared between the reconstruction scores(P>0.05).The sensitivity,specificity,negative predictive values and the positive predictive value of the multi-planar reconstruction after multi-slice reconstruction were 91.5%,91.0%,91.9%and 90.5%,respectively.Conclusion:The multi-slice spiral CT multi-planar reconstruction technique in the application of lung space-occupying lesions have clear avatar and free reconstruction area,which can effectively distinguish between benign and malignant conditions.
